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Parking Lot: Larger lots typically require more materials and labor.
- Extent of Damage: Minor cracks are less expensive to fix than extensive potholes or structural damage.
- Type of Repair Needed: Different repairs like sealcoating, patching, or resurfacing have varying costs.
- Materials Used: High-quality materials can be more costly but offer better durability.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Port Orchard may vary based on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Weather Conditions: Repairs done in optimal weather conditions may be less expensive than those done during adverse weather.
- Accessibility: Easy-to-access locations can reduce labor time and cost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Port Orchard, WA) |
---|---|
Crack Filling | $0.50 - $1.00 per linear foot |
Sealcoating | $0.15 - $0.25 per square foot |
Pothole Repair | $50 - $150 per pothole |
Resurfacing | $1.50 - $3.00 per square foot |
Line Striping | $300 - $500 for a standard lot |
Full Replacement | $4.00 - $7.00 per square foot |
